Ana Ortiz — Biography
Born on January 25, 1971, Ana Ortiz is an actress who has graced both the stage and screen. Her artistic journey began with a dedication to ballet and singing in her formative years, leading her to the halls of the University of the Arts. Ortiz first honed her craft in theatrical productions before making her mark in early 2000s television with brief appearances on NBC's Kristin in 2001 and A.U.S.A. in 2003. She also lent her talents to recurring parts in Over There and Boston Legal. However, it was her portrayal of Hilda Suarez in the ABC comedy-drama Ugly Betty, from 2006 to 2010, that truly propelled her into the public consciousness. Ortiz's filmography includes roles in Labor Pains (2009) and Big Mommas: Like Father, Like Son (2011), as well as the lead in the 2008 television movie Little Girl Lost: The Delimar Vera Story. From 2013 to 2016, she captivated audiences as Marisol Suarez in the Lifetime series Devious Maids, a performance that earned her an Imagen Award for Best Actress - Television. More recently, in 2020, Ortiz took on the role of Isabel Salazar, the mother of the titular character, in the Hulu series Love, Victor.
